Web6 de jun. de 2024 · The government body in Northern Ireland which does the police records checking is called AccessNI. The general ethos is the same as ... is a trading style of … WebIn Northern Ireland, criminal record disclosure checks are carried out by AccessNI. Organisations that want to request AccessNI disclosure on candidates must either become a registered body (this is only suitable for large organisations) or use an umbrella body that is registered with AccessNI. WebOnline AccessNI checks. AccessNI criminal record checks are for people living or working in Northern Ireland. An AccessNI check can only be undertaken on people aged 16 years old or over. The only exception is for family members of an applicant, under 16, where the applicant is registering as a childminder or wants to adopt or foster a child.
